I have found that in all these area's of our lives, the bottom line is whether or not we trust God. We really like to think we are in control so the notion of putting our work and finances after these other areas seems irresponsible to many. Because we tend to disorder these areas, usually having vocation/economical at the top, all the other areas tend to scream for attention - we are exhausted all the time, so our relationships suffer, we don't have time for exercise or rest and certainly no time to think! And, we think as long as we cram in church on Sunday, we are good! I think we also struggle constantly with wrong thinking - thinking that our identity is in our work or our various roles in life, so by dealing with the Spiritual, then mental (emotional)/physical areas is key, because if we are not thinking correctly, nothing else will work well. This is exactly what I need right now 😅 I love this framework for a couple reasons. First, I've spent enough time establishing my spiritual habits that I realized I never contemplated what the next domain should be to "build upon" that (using a language Paul used in 1 Cor 3:10-15). I was gonna go straight to vocation, until you made a great point on the physical habits first. I admit I tend to overlook it, but it just makes a lot of sense to move "outward" 😄 Second, I was intrigued to see recreational come before vocational. Regardless of whether that's applicable for all, I feel that that is exactly what I need. As someone who can easily turn to productivity for my worth, prioritizing Sabbath and enjoying God's blessings (Ecclesiastes 5:19) would actually help me to put the gospel at the forefront of my mind when it's so easy to default to "works righteousness". At least, that's particularly relevant to me. Stewarding work and finances should be, as you said, the natural outworking of a heart fully assured and right with God first. 😊 Thanks for such an insightful video Reagan!
